def encode_text_string(s: str) -> str:
|
|
'''Encode text string to hex string for use in a PDF
|
|
|
|
From PDF 32000-1:2008 a string object may be included in hexademical form
|
|
if it is enclosed in angle brackets. For general Unicode the string should
|
|
be UTF-16 (big endian) with byte order marks. A non-hexademical
|
|
presentation is possible but this is preferable since it allows the output
|
|
Postscript file to be completely ASCII.
|
|
'''
|
|
if s == '':
|
|
return ''
|
|
utf16_bytes = s.encode('utf-16be')
|
|
ascii_hex_bytes = codecs.encode(b'\xfe\xff' + utf16_bytes, 'hex')
|
|
ascii_hex_str = ascii_hex_bytes.decode('ascii').lower()
|
|
return ascii_hex_str
